True or False? Grain is the most common food allergen in pets.
Answer: False
Virtually any food ingredient can trigger an allergy; however, grain is rarely the offender. The most common food allergens in cats are fish, beef, chicken and dairy and the most common food allergens in dogs are beef, chicken (including eggs) and dairy. Food allergies can develop at any time in your pet’s life, even if your pet has been eating the same diet for years. If your pet suddenly begins showing signs of allergies (e.g., itching, redness of skin and ears, repeated ear infections), their diet—even if it’s been fed long term—should be considered as a possible cause. If your pet has signs of allergies, your veterinarian can help with diagnosis and find what treatment works for your pet.
